Class PGVRuleFactory
java.lang.Object
no.entur.schema2proto.generateproto.PGVRuleFactory
-
Field Summary
Fields -
Constructor Summary
ConstructorsConstructorDescriptionPGVRuleFactory(Schema2ProtoConfiguration configuration, SchemaParser schemaParser) -
Method Summary
Modifier and TypeMethodDescriptionList<com.squareup.wire.schema.internal.parser.OptionElement>getValidationRule(XSAttributeDecl attributeDecl) List<com.squareup.wire.schema.internal.parser.OptionElement>getValidationRule(XSParticle parentParticle) List<com.squareup.wire.schema.internal.parser.OptionElement>getValidationRule(XSSimpleType simpleType)
-
Field Details
-
VALIDATE_RULES_NAME
- See Also:
-
-
Constructor Details
-
PGVRuleFactory
-
-
Method Details
-
getValidationRule
public List<com.squareup.wire.schema.internal.parser.OptionElement> getValidationRule(XSParticle parentParticle) -
getValidationRule
public List<com.squareup.wire.schema.internal.parser.OptionElement> getValidationRule(XSAttributeDecl attributeDecl) -
getValidationRule
public List<com.squareup.wire.schema.internal.parser.OptionElement> getValidationRule(XSSimpleType simpleType) -
getValidationRuleForBasicTypes
-